Today, Bitcoin and Ethereum ETFs in the US have shown significant funding inflows, reflecting growing interest from institutional investors.
Funding Flows into Bitcoin ETFs
Today, **US Bitcoin ETFs** experienced a net inflow of 2,617 BTC, while **Ethereum ETFs** recorded inflows of 36,439 ETH. Major players, including **BlackRock's iShares** and **Fidelity**, significantly contributed to these inflows.
